The Psychology Behind the Incentive

The psychological principles underlying casino gaming are cleverly exploited by these platforms. Variable ratio reinforcement schedules, where rewards are dispensed unpredictably, are particularly effective in creating a sense of anticipation and encouraging continued play. The near-miss effect, where a player almost wins, also contributes to this addictive cycle. These subtle psychological mechanisms can lead players to overestimate their chances of winning and underestimate the risks involved. Further, the social aspect, often facilitated through live dealer games and online communities, adds another layer of engagement, making the experience more compelling and potentially more problematic for vulnerable individuals. Therefore, awareness of these tactics is a critical component of responsible gaming.

Navigating Risks: A Critical Evaluation

Despite the attractive facade, online casino gaming is fraught with risks. The potential for financial loss is perhaps the most obvious concern. Games are designed with a house edge, meaning that over the long term, the casino is statistically guaranteed to profit. While individual players may experience short-term wins, the odds are always stacked in favor of the house. This inherent imbalance underlines the importance of viewing casino gaming as a form of entertainment, rather than a reliable source of income. Beyond financial risks, there’s also the potential for addiction. The addictive nature of these games can lead to compulsive gambling, negatively impacting personal relationships, work performance, and overall well-being. Responsible gaming is not merely a suggestion; it’s a necessity.

Identifying Problem Gambling

Recognizing the signs of problem gambling is crucial for both individuals and their loved ones. These signs can include spending increasing amounts of time and money on gambling, neglecting personal responsibilities, lying about gambling habits, and experiencing mood swings related to wins and losses. A preoccupation with gambling, chasing losses, and a sense of desperation when trying to stop are also red flags. If you or someone you know is exhibiting these behaviors, seeking help is essential. Numerous resources are available, including support groups, counseling services, and self-exclusion programs, all aimed at assisting individuals in overcoming their gambling problems. Recognizing the issue is the first step toward recovery.

Legal and Regulatory Frameworks

The legal landscape surrounding online casinos is complex and varies significantly from country to country. Some jurisdictions have fully legalized and regulated online gambling, implementing stringent measures to protect players and ensure fair play. These regulations typically include licensing requirements, responsible gaming provisions, and mechanisms for resolving disputes. Other jurisdictions maintain a more restrictive approach, prohibiting online gambling altogether or allowing only certain types of games. The lack of consistent regulation across borders creates challenges for both players and authorities, making it difficult to combat illegal operations and protect vulnerable individuals. Understanding the regulations in your specific jurisdiction is crucial before engaging in online casino gaming.
